#EverythingAboutConcrete #MikeDayConcrete #ConcreteForming In this video I'm going to show you how I form a 1.5" overhang when I install forms for a concrete patio slab. The formed overhang helps to hide the seam between the bottom of the patio slab and the top of the foundation wall. Without the formed overhang, when you strip the forms after pouring and finishing the concrete, you'll see where the patio slab sits on top of the concrete wall. If the backfill doesn't cover the seam, then it may not look as nice as you'd like. By overhanging the concrete, the seam is a lot less noticeable and looks a lot better when you don't cover it with backfill. I have to form up a lot of my concrete pours.
